Overview of Redmi Note 13

The Redmi Note 13 is part of Xiaomi’s popular series known for delivering solid performance at a budget-friendly price. It features a 6.67-inch AMOLED display, a 50MP main camera, and a large 5000mAh battery. Powered by a MediaTek Dimensity processor, it is suitable for everyday tasks, gaming, and multimedia consumption.

Comparison of Key Features

Display

The Redmi Note 13 offers a vibrant AMOLED display with a 120Hz refresh rate, providing smooth visuals. The Samsung Galaxy A54 also features an AMOLED screen with similar specifications, while others like the Realme 11 and Motorola G73 have LCD screens with lower refresh rates.

Camera

The Redmi Note 13’s 50MP main camera provides sharp images and decent low-light performance. The Samsung Galaxy A54 boasts a 50MP sensor with optical image stabilization, enhancing photo quality. In contrast, some competitors have lower-resolution cameras or fewer features.

Performance

Equipped with a MediaTek Dimensity chipset, the Redmi Note 13 delivers reliable performance for most users. The Galaxy A54 uses an Exynos processor, which is comparable in everyday tasks. The other models may have slightly less powerful processors, affecting gaming and multitasking capabilities.
